Output 3cd0d2d33cbfef89891c0d076d2c4e5a6d20f660ce6c537c5647cdfcf42a264f:0

value
17489091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 297c7fedc24ee78974b27a475c2e1522828b0a10 OP_EQUAL
address
35UNmoRCafgXSpNL7y5U19GK67sbquPysA
transaction
3cd0d2d33cbfef89891c0d076d2c4e5a6d20f660ce6c537c5647cdfcf42a264f
confirmations
514200
spent
true